Uses
Used in Pharmaceutical Industry:
1-(4-chlorophenyl)-3-(dimethylamino)propan-1-ol is used as a pharmaceutical intermediate for the synthesis of various drugs, including antihistamines and sedatives. Its structural composition allows for the creation of a wide range of medicinal compounds that can address different health conditions.
Used in Chemical Industry:
1-(4-chlorophenyl)-3-(dimethylamino)propan-1-ol has also been investigated for its potential use as a chiral resolving agent in chromatography. The presence of the chlorophenyl and dimethylamino groups in its structure makes it a valuable tool for separating enantiomers, which is crucial in the development and production of high-quality pharmaceuticals and other chemical products.
Check Digit Verification of cas no
The CAS Registry Mumber 16254-22-1 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,6,2,5 and 4 respectively; the second part has 2 digits, 2 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 16254-22:
(7*1)+(6*6)+(5*2)+(4*5)+(3*4)+(2*2)+(1*2)=91
91 % 10 = 1
So 16254-22-1 is a valid CAS Registry Number.
